Output 56aeb982df689e8d66950cd8fe741ecb149961728fb8d40f2174af81c09e53dc:3

value
343935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4529662905d3667171f627683ed4dcd094715f OP_EQUAL
address
3QsUQi4xbpfh1k3WX1hRhk2WLCmreAygSv
transaction
56aeb982df689e8d66950cd8fe741ecb149961728fb8d40f2174af81c09e53dc